Ver Mensaje Individual
  #1 (permalink)  
Antiguo 27/05/2003, 10:42
haven
 
Fecha de Ingreso: febrero-2002
Ubicación: Navarra
Mensajes: 701
Antigüedad: 23 años, 3 meses
Puntos: 2
Problema con bucle infinito

Tengo una lista de correo la cual me envia un correo a todos los usuarios de esa lista, el problema es que no se que pasa con el código que lo que hago es mandar 5000 mensajes seguidos al primero que figura en mi base de datos (vaya, jeje, esto debe ser un mailbomber, coñe, pero no quiero eso,no veas que rato he estado para borrar los 5000 mensajes que e enviado a mi correo ). el código es este:


strAccessDB = "../administracion_file/entrada"


strCon = "DRIVER={Microsoft Access Driver (*.mdb)};uid=;pwd=JJ; DBQ=" & Server.MapPath(strAccessDB)

Set RSts = Server.CreateObject("ADODB.Recordset")
SQLts = "SELECT * FROM CORREO"
RSts.open SQLts, strCon

Do While Not RSts.eof

set mailObj = Server.CreateObject("CDONTS.NewMail")

sCuerpo = "DATOS"

mailObj.BodyFormat = 0
mailObj.MailFormat = 0

mailObj.From = "[email protected]"

mailObj.To = RSts("Email")

mailObj.Subject = "MENSAJE"
mailObj.Body = sCuerpo
mailObj.Send

Loop

Alguien sabe como solucionar esto????

Un saludo